ImageJ is an image analysis program extensively used in the biological sciences and beyond. Due to its ease of use, recordable macro language, and extensible plug-in architecture, ImageJ enjoys contributions from non-programmers, amateur programmers, and professional developers alike.

This paper is intended as an overview of recent developments and trends. It wishes to pro- vide a short survey of the principal families of approaches, their use and limitations. Algo- rithms generic or specific to particular imaging modalities are not given here (see for exam- ple (10)). Section 2 presents the analysis pipeline, which accepts as input raw data and provides some form of processing or interpretation. Two basic processing paradigms are summarized in section 3, namely linear (or pseudo-linear) and morphological.
